On Tuesday evening, Chonburi Immigration Police arrested a 56 year old Australian male national at a bar and restaurant on Soi Noi in East Pattaya.   Mr. Luciano Glavina was arrested for suspected extortion, as he apparently recently posted nude photos of a Thai woman on the Internet, after she refused to pay up and be blackmailed.  Instead the unnamed woman contacted the police to take action as the photos have ruined her reputation.   Luciano, originally from Italy, was also accused of displaying explicit pornography on the Internet, and an arrest warrant was issued in Rayong Court since late September.  Immigration got involved and traced Luciano to Pattaya and surveyed the restaurant which was believed to be his favourite haunt.  Sure enough, he turned up that evening and was immediately arrested.  He denied all charges, but was detained before being sent to Rayong for further investigation.
